Location: Remote | Travel up to 25%

 

Turn the world’s most complex shipping data into decisions customers can act on.


At Green Mountain Technology, we help large, complex shippers reduce costs, enhance delivery experiences, and build sustainable competitive advantages through technology, analytics, and logistics expertise.

 

We are seeking a Strategic Solutions Manager to lead customer relationships, oversee parcel and transportation analysis, and develop the team responsible for delivering solutions. The ideal candidate brings customer-facing consulting experience, strong analytical skills, and the executive presence to translate network data into actionable cost and service improvements.

 

What You’ll Do

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ned customers, owning executive-level relationships and day-to-day delivery.
  • Lead parcel network analysis and modeling to inform network evaluations, carrier contract decisions, and optimization strategies.
  • Partner with customers to identify cost and service improvement opportunities and track projected and realized savings.
  • Develop reports, dashboards, and visualizations that turn complex shipping data into actionable insights.
  • Present findings and recommendations to audiences ranging from analysts and operations managers to senior and C-suite executives.
  • Lead recurring and ad hoc customer meetings, establishing clear priorities, action items, and accountability.
  • Lead, coach, and develop a team of Solutions Engineers by setting objectives and KPIs, providing consistent feedback, and supporting individual development plans.
  • Build scalable financial tools and models for business reviews, planning, and forecasting.
  • Develop and automate analytical models and delivery processes to improve scalability, quality, and speed to insight.
  • Support business development and pre-sales activities by shaping solutions, business cases, and proposals.
  • Act as the liaison between carriers and customers to resolve billing and contract-related issues.
  • Ensure all reports, models, and deliverables are thoroughly tested and quality-checked before reaching the customer.

 

What You’ll Bring

  • 5+ years of customer-facing account management experience in transportation, parcel, logistics, or supply chain, including experience leading analytical projects.
  • Demonstrated success managing executive-level customer relationships and clearly communicating complex findings.
  • Strong analytical skills, including advanced Microsoft Excel and SQL, with the ability to extract insights from large data sets.
  • Experience leading, coaching, mentoring, and developing team members.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Engineering, Logistics, MIS, Business, or a related discipline, or equivalent practical experience.
  • Ability to remain customer-focused and effective in a fast-paced, rapidly evolving environment.
  • A strong sense of ownership, demonstrated by meeting deadlines, taking accountability, and treating mistakes as opportunities to learn.



What Will Set You Apart

  • Experience with Power BI, Tableau, or comparable business intelligence tools.
  • Transportation optimization, carrier pricing, or parcel analytics experience.
  • Advanced expertise in financial forecasting and process automation.
  • Project management and business development experience.
  • Consulting experience, particularly with enterprise or Fortune 500 customers.

 

Why Green Mountain Technology

Green Mountain Technology is a technology-enabled parcel logistics management and advisory firm. Large, complex shippers turn to us to continuously improve customer delivery experiences and the cost to make them possible.

 

Innovation isn't an initiative, it's our culture. We were founded on a belief in using technology paired with talented and knowledgeable professionals in shipping, logistics, data analytics, and technology to create meaningful financial outcomes for our customers. We believe in continuously innovating differentiated value and empowering our people to lead with curiosity, creativity, and ownership.

 

Green Mountain Technology offers eligible team members medical coverage with two plan options, along with dental and vision benefits. Our HSA-qualified high-deductible health plan includes a generous company contribution, with optional health care and dependent care flexible spending accounts. Company-paid basic life insurance and short- and long-term disability coverage are available from day one, with voluntary supplemental plans also offered. Additional benefits include fully remote work options in many US states, paid holidays, PTO, Summer Hours with no waiting period, and a 401(k) plan with an automatic company contribution.
